I have been working in Education for many years, and my opinion is: the role of Admissions is wider than just to get the student enrolled in a program. Admissions should be working closely with all the departments and all the students until graduation - to help students in all the stages of studying: keep track of their progress, make sure they are satisfied with the course(s)they chose, help them with their credit transfer process, assisting them in filling out for financial aid, etc.
